Everyone who applies for a first adult passport, without previously having held a child's passport, WILL have to attend an interview and that is why it takes up to 6 weeks.0
-
This was introduced last year, but at that time they may have had to attend an interview as not all the interview centres were up and running. However from this year it is all first time adult applicants who have never previously held a child's passport.0
